首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
注意:下面出现的“考生文件夹”均为c:\wexam\25160001。 请根据以下各小题的要求设计Visual Basic应用程序(包括界面和代码)。 (1) 在名称为Form1的窗体上放置一个名称为Drive1的Drive ListBox控件
注意:下面出现的“考生文件夹”均为c:\wexam\25160001。 请根据以下各小题的要求设计Visual Basic应用程序(包括界面和代码)。 (1) 在名称为Form1的窗体上放置一个名称为Drive1的Drive ListBox控件
admin
2009-02-25
44
问题
注意:下面出现的“考生文件夹”均为c:\wexam\25160001。
请根据以下各小题的要求设计Visual Basic应用程序(包括界面和代码)。
(1) 在名称为Form1的窗体上放置一个名称为Drive1的Drive ListBox控件,一个名称为Dir1的 DirListBox控件和一个名称为Filel的FileListBox控件。程序运行时,可以对系统中的文件进行浏览;当双击File1中的文件名时,用MsgBox显示文件名(不显示路径名)。如图16-1所示。
注意:程序中不得使用任何变量;保存时必须存放在考生文件夹下,窗体文件名为sjt1.frm,工程文件名为sjt1.vbp。
(2) 在名称为Form1的窗体上放置一个名为Text1的文本框控件和一个名为Timer1的计时器控件,程序运行后,文本框中显示的是当前的时间,而且每一秒文本框中所显示的时间都会随时间的变化而改变。
注意:程序中不得使用任何变量;保存时必须存放在考生文件夹下,窗体文件名为sjt2.frm,工程文件名为sjt2.vbp,如图16-2所示。
选项
答案
在窗体上建立好控件后,先设置控件属性,再编写事件过程。 文件系统控件有3种:驱动器列表框(DriveListBox),目录列表框(DirListBox)和文件列表框(FileListBox)。3个文件系统控件必须协调工作才能构成一个文件管理系统,当用户在驱动器列表框中选择一个新的列表框或在当目录列表框Path的属性改变都触发Change事件,将三者(利用本题中3个对象的名称)实现同步的代码为:File1.Path=Dir1.Path,Dir1.Path= Drive1.Drive。双击触发DblClick事件弹出MsgBox显示文件名,其格式为:MsgBox提示[,按钮][,标题]。解题步骤: 第一步:建立界面并设置控件属性。程序中用到的控件及其属性见表16-1。 [*] 第二步:编写程序代码。 参考代码: Option ExpliCit Private Sub Dir1_Change() File1.Path=Dir1.Path End Sub Private Sub Drive1_Change() Dir1.Path=Drive1.Drive End Sub Private Sub File1_dblClick() MsgBox Filel.FileName End Sub Private Sub Form_Load() Dir1.Path=Drive1.Drive File1.Path=Dir1.Path End Sub 第三步:调试并运行程序。 第四步:按题目要求存盘。 (2)在窗体上建立好控件后,先设置控件的属性,再编写事件过程。 时钟控件作用是以一定的时间间隔激发计时器事件(Timer)而执行相应程序代码,其Interval属性决定时间间隔的长短,以毫秒为单位,所以要实现每一秒文本框的时间改变只要使该属性设置为1000即可,要使程序运行后取得当前时间可用Time函数取得,程序用到的Str函数将其中的内容转化为字符串。解题步骤: 第一步:建立界面并设置控件属性。程序中用到的控件及其属性见表16-2。 [*] 第三步:调试并运行程序。 第四步:按题目要求存盘。
解析
转载请注明原文地址:https://kaotiyun.com/show/UQ1p777K
本试题收录于:
二级VB题库NCRE全国计算机二级分类
0
二级VB
NCRE全国计算机二级
相关试题推荐
结构化程序设计所规定的3种基本控制结构是顺序结构、选择结构和【】。
一个类只有实现了【】接口,它的对象才是可串行化的。
当Applet程序中的init()方法为下列代码时,运行后用户界面会出现什么样的情况。publicvoidinit(){setLayout(newBorderLayout());add("North",n
mouseDragged()方法是MouseMotionListener接口中的抽象方法,该方法的参数是【】类。
在下列程序的下划线处,填入适当语句使程序能正确执行并输出异常栈信息。publicclassThrowableException{publicstaticvoidmain(Stringargs[]{tr
在下列关系运算中,不改变关系表中的属性个数但能减少元组个数的是
设x,y,max均为int型变量,x,y已赋值。用三目条件运算符求x,y的最大值,这个赋值语句应是max=【】。
赋值表达式是由位于赋值运算符左边的变量和右边的【】组成。
Java虚拟机中的______模块既负责管理针对各种类型数据库软件的JDBC驱动程序,也负责和用户的应用程序交互,为Java应用程序建立起基于JDBC机制的数据库连接。()
数据处理的剐、单位是_________。
随机试题
A、Kidsshouldlearnnottobeafraidofmonsters.B、FirefightersplayanimportantroleinAmerica.C、Carelessnesscanresultin
自然资源统计的范围()
A、2/3B、3/2C、2D、3A
下列表述放在“我们要学习文件”之后,可以消除这句话歧义的一项是()。
公路工程进度计划的检查结果可以通过()体现和分析。
甲公司从事建材生产作业,其在外地设有一分公司乙,并且已取得营业执照;2016年8月,因生产规模扩大,乙公司决定新招一批生产工人。随后乙公司在当地招聘了包括小王和小李在内的15名工人,9月1日开始工作。乙公司与应聘个人口头约定了工作内容和工资数额。
下列选项中,属于行政事实行为的是()。
写一个建立堆的算法:从空堆开始,依次读入元素,调用上题中堆插入算法将其插入堆中。
GeneralWesleyClarkrecentlydiscoveredaholeinhispersonalsecurity—hiscellphone.Aresourcefulblogger,hopingtocall
Englishhasbeensuccessfullypromoted,andhasbeeneagerlyadoptedinthegloballinguisticmarketplace.Onesymptomoftheim
最新回复
(
0
)